A differential backup contains all the changes since the last full.
An incremental backup contains only the changes from the last inc.
If full run Sunday, and diff s made daily, the diff run on Thursday would contain all the changes since the last full on Sunday. The Thursday file would be chosen for restore and the restore would be made of Sunday Full and Thursday Diff. After the restore, the computer would look as it did after Thursday backup.
As opposed to Inc.
If full on Sunday, and inc made daily, the inc run on Thursday would only contain the changes since Wednesday. In order to get the computer to be the same as it was when the Thursday inc take, the restore would require the restore of the backups from Sun, Mon, Tue, Wed, Thu. with the Thursday Inc being the file chosen for restore.

That option is in the scheme settings for Full backups in the automatic cleanup section. You shouldn't see it if doing Incrementals or Differentials. However, tasks sometimes get screwed up. Have you tried recreating the backup task?
Are you running a Full backup and then trying to run a Differential? Normally, you'd just set the scheme to Differential and it will create a Full automatically on the first backup.
What happens on the third backup run? Does it also try to create a Full?
Does the log state that a Differential was created or does it say it was a Full?
